Abstract

The utility model discloses a kind of refrigerator LED area light source, including temp. controlling box and be arranged at the LED lamp panel on temp. controlling box and diffuser plate mask, LED lamp panel is provided with multiple LED lamp bead, LED lamp bead is covered with lens, diffuser plate mask and LED lamp panel be arranged in parallel, and diffuser plate mask is located at the side of the exiting surface of LED lamp bead of LED lamp panel.This utility model has advantages below compared to existing technology:The light source that its LED lamp bead sends, first passes through lens refraction and sends, then scatter through diffuser plate mask, distribute light over is full and uniform again, it is achieved thereby that the purpose of area source, uniformly, light is soft, solves the problems, such as LED point light source dazzle for luminosity.

Description

A kind of refrigerator LED area light source
Technical field
This utility model is related to a kind of refrigerator LED area light source.
Background technology
Refrigerator lighting is in the majority with the LED illumination of green, environmental protection, energy-conservation at present, and light emitting species have point source, area source two Kind.With the raising of living standards of the people, the requirement for lighting source also gradually steps up, and area source is soft, bright with its light Degree uniformly, is increasingly favored by consumer.Current area source scheme is by arranging light guide plate at refrigerator back mostly To realize point source to the conversion of area source, its requirement to structure is very high, and cost is more expensive, assembling is complicated, and portability is very Low.
Utility model content
The purpose of this utility model is to overcome the deficiencies in the prior art, there is provided a kind of refrigerator LED area light source.
This utility model is achieved through the following technical solutions:
A kind of refrigerator LED area light source, including temp. controlling box and be arranged at LED lamp panel on described temp. controlling box and diffusion plate face Cover, described LED lamp panel is provided with multiple LED lamp bead, and described LED lamp bead is covered with lens, described diffuser plate mask and described LED Lamp plate be arranged in parallel, and described diffuser plate mask is located at the side of the exiting surface of LED lamp bead of described LED lamp panel.
Divider resistance, adapter and pcb board are additionally provided with described LED lamp panel.
Multiple LED lamp bead of described LED lamp panel are uniformly arranged in a row.
Described lens are PMMA lens.
Described diffuser plate mask is frosting in the one side towards described LED lamp panel, is provided with one layer outside described frosting All light oxidant layer.
The distance between described diffuser plate mask and described LED lamp panel are 20~25mm.
Described LED lamp panel is provided with evenly spaced three LED lamp bead.
This utility model has advantages below compared to existing technology:
A kind of refrigerator LED area light source that this utility model provides, the light source that its LED lamp bead sends, first pass through lens refraction Send, then scatter through diffuser plate mask again, distribute light over is full and uniform, it is achieved thereby that the purpose of area source, light Brightness uniformity, light is soft, solves the problems, such as LED point light source dazzle.Meanwhile, this utility model is compared with the light guide plate of conventional The area source structure of formula is compared, simple for structure, easy to assembly, low cost.

Specific embodiment
Below embodiment of the present utility model is elaborated, the present embodiment is being front with technical solutions of the utility model Put and implemented, give detailed embodiment and specific operating process, but protection domain of the present utility model does not limit In following embodiments.
Referring to Fig. 1, Fig. 2, present embodiment discloses a kind of refrigerator LED area light source, including temp. controlling box 2 and be arranged at temperature control LED lamp panel 1 on box 2 and diffuser plate mask 3, temp. controlling box 2 is used for supporting LED lamp panel 1 and diffuser plate mask 3.In LED lamp panel 1 It is provided with multiple LED lamp bead 11, multiple LED lamp bead 11 are uniformly arranged in a row in LED lamp panel 1, for example, can be equal in a row Three LED lamp bead 11 of even arrangement.Divider resistance 13, adapter 14 and pcb board 15 are additionally provided with LED lamp panel 1.LED lamp bead 11 It is covered with lens 12, diffuser plate mask 3 is be arranged in parallel with LED lamp panel 1, and diffuser plate mask 3 is located at the LED lamp bead of LED lamp panel 1 The side of 11 exiting surface, the distance between diffuser plate mask 3 and LED lamp panel 1 are 20~25mm, and distance closely easily produces very much light , dazzle in source hot spot;Far it is easily reduced very much the brightness of area source, or even the defect of diffuser plate mask 3 edge no brightness occurs, Thus diffuser plate mask 3 and LED lamp panel 1 are arranged on suitable in the distance and can reach the area source effect that brightness is high, uniformity is good.
Wherein, LED lamp bead 11 can adopt adopting surface mounted LED light emitting diode, glow color be white, colour temperature be 2700~ 6500K, color rendering index minimum 80, representative value is 82, and half light intensity angle is 120 °.Lens 12 are the circular PMMA lens of hot spot, Its a diameter of Φ 13mm, light transmittance is 92%, and refractive index is 1.49, and lens 12 can change LED lamp bead 11 light source by refraction and send out The radiation direction going out, increases lighting angle and the uniformity of light.Divider resistance 13 is many 300 ohm of resistance, according to every 4 A road loop provides stable 3.3VDC running voltage to a LED lamp bead 11.Adapter 14 is a side-mounted power supply Terminal, is connected with the wire harness of LED lamp panel 1, powers source as LED lamp panel 112VDC.Pcb board 15 is the base material of LED lamp panel 1, Comprise wiring route, meet the flame retardant rating of UL 94V-0.
Diffuser plate mask 3 is frosting in the one side towards LED lamp panel 1, is provided with one layer of all light oxidant layer outside frosting.By Increased one layer of all light oxidant layer outside the frosting of diffuser plate mask 3, possess high transmission rate, the optical signature such as high diffusibility, Light fully can be scattered, strengthen uniformity, on the premise of reaching good light transmittance, possess good light source point Battle array shielding.The thickness of this diffuser plate mask 3 is 1.5mm, and light transmittance is 50%~60%;Its frosting mist degree be 99.5 ± 1%.
After supplying 12VDC power supply to LED lamp panel 1 by adapter 14, acted on by the partial pressure of divider resistance 13, every LED lamp bead 11 obtains stable 3.3VDC voltage respectively, lights luminous, and light reflects after lens 12 and sends, and changes former The light trend come is so as to distribution face homogenization;Light increases emission of light angle so as to shine after lens 12 simultaneously Penetrate face wider.Dissipated through all light oxidant layer of its frosting again when diffuser plate mask 3 is reached by the light after lens 12 Penetrate so as to the light distribution on diffuser plate mask 3 surface obtains full and uniform, it is achieved thereby that the purpose of area source, give brightness Uniform area source effect.
In the design of refrigerator lighting, can be according to the size of illuminated area, the factor such as volume of refrigerator lighting, by changing The size of LED lamp bead 11, the quantity of lens 12 and diffuser plate mask 3, shape etc., the area source effect required for realizing, strengthen The experience sense of user is subject to.
This utility model is simple for structure, easy to assembly, low cost, portable strong, can be applicable in refrigerator lighting. By this utility model, not only can solve the dazzle of point source, and achieve the effect of area source, enhance selling of refrigerator Point.
